Protest in Pune: Gig Workers and Transporters Unite for Strike on October 25

Pune, 19th Oct 2023: Food delivery agents, along with cab and auto-rickshaw drivers operating under application-based aggregators in Pune and Pimpri Chinchwad, have declared a strike on October 25 to protest the state government’s inaction regarding the Gig Workers Registration and Welfare Act. The proposed legislation aims to safeguard workers’ rights and protect them from various forms of employer harassment.

In addition to the Gig Workers Act, protestors are calling on the state government to implement the Cab Aggregator Act in alignment with the central government’s Cab Aggregator guidelines. Keshav Kshirsagar, president of the Baghtoy Rickshawala organization, emphasized the urgency of introducing both acts during the upcoming winter session.

The Gig Workers Registration and Welfare Act, already in place in Rajasthan, serves as a model for Maharashtra. The strike enjoys the support of delivery agents, auto-rickshaw, and cab drivers affiliated with companies like OLA, Uber, Zomato, Swiggy, among others, who have pledged their participation in the October 25 bandh.

It is worth noting that the RTO Pune has previously declared the operation of auto-rickshaws under application-based aggregators as illegal, due to the absence of proper guidelines for aggregator services concerning two-wheelers and three-wheelers in Maharashtra.
